Alfie is tagged as: indie, indie pop, manchester, britpop, indie rock There are two acts called Alfie: one from the UK and one from Norway. 1) Alfie were a Manchester based indie-folk band. They were originally signed to Twisted Nerve records, but moved to Regal/Parlophone Records. On October 26 2005, they announced they were breaking up: http://www.nme.com/news/alfie/21358 Band members * Lee Gorton (vocals)|* Ian Smith (guitar)|* Matt McGeever (guitar, cello)|* Sam Morris (bass, keyboards, french horn)|* Sean Kelly (drums) a much loved but now sorely missed, one off, northwest/midlands hybrid of instinctive salfordian folkies and classicaly trained, satirical, psychedelic enthusiasts. did 2 albums on manchesters finest and most influential independant label, twisted nerve. their debut, ‘if you happy with you need do nothing’ was a sketchy, low-fi, but charming collection of 3 early e.p’s that was then followed up with their twisted nerve debut proper, ‘a word in your ear’. this record saw the band move a leap closer to the string and harmony drenched, sunshine psychedelia they were planning for their 3rd album, their debut record on regal/parlophone, ‘do you imagine things?’. none of these albums sold particulary well so the band did their best and put together their 4th long player, ‘cry...
